G06Q30/0635

SYSTEMS AND METHODS FOR INTERFACING BETWEEN A SALES MANAGEMENT SYSTEM AND A PROJECT PLANNING SYSTEM

The present disclosure facilitates interfacing between a sales management system and a project planning system. In some embodiments, the system includes an interface and schedule engine, both executing on a server. The interface can parse a sales order from the sales management system into products and project tasks within the products. The products can also include at least one of a labor product, a parts product, and an agreements product. The schedule engine can generate schedule tasks corresponding to the project tasks, determine a performance order of the schedule tasks, and combine the schedule tasks into schedule phases based on the performance order. The schedule engine can determine a performance order of the schedule phases and combine the schedule phases into a schedule component based on the performance order. The interface can transmit the schedule component to the project planning system for execution.

Roadside assistance service provider assignment system

Aspects of the disclosure provide a computer-implemented method and system for the assignment of roadside assistance service providers such as tow trucks to distressed vehicles/drivers requiring roadside assistance. The methods and systems may include a roadside assistance service provider system with a collection module, an assignment module, and a feedback module. The collection module collects roadside assistance service provider information and historical statistics from real-world information and stores the information in a database that may then be analyzed using particular rules and formulas. The assignment module assigns particular roadside assistance service providers to particular distressed vehicles/drivers based on one or more characteristics. The feedback module may provide near real-time cues to the tow truck driver's mobile device, such as alerting when the amount of time spent on a task exceeds a predefined threshold, flagging high priority tasks/assignments, providing a step-by-step checklist for the repair.

Merchant Selection Model for Dynamic Management of Add-Ons for Delivery Service Orders

Systems and method for dynamically managing add-on orders within a delivery service application. For example, a computer-implemented method includes obtaining data indicative of a primary order request. The method includes selecting, ranking, and displaying menu items for add-on orders associated with a primary order. The method includes obtaining user data provided by a user through a user interface associated with a delivery service application. The method includes determining, in response to obtaining the user data, that the primary order request is eligible for an add-on order. The method includes determining merchants for the add-on order. The selected merchants can be determined from a plurality of candidate merchants based at least in part on analysis of merchant-specific data relative to the user data indicative of the primary order request. The method includes updating the user interface to display data associated with the one or more selected merchants for the add-on order.

Systems and methods for product ordering and delivery for inmates
11810180 · 2023-11-07 · ·

Disclosed herein is a system that includes an order processing subsystem and a delivery processing subsystem comprising at least one database and one or more processors. The one or more processors of the delivery processing subsystem is configured to receive a request for a user to access the delivery processing subsystem and a scanning device, authenticate the user by verifying the request with user credentials stored in the at least one database, provide the user with access to the delivery processing subsystem and the scanning device, receive scanned data from the scanning device, retrieve package data regarding a package for an inmate based on the scanned data from the scanning device, and generate, based on the package data, a route in the correctional facility for delivery of the package to the inmate in the correctional facility, wherein the route does not include an identity of the inmate.

SYSTEM FOR EATERY ORDERING WITH MOBILE INTERFACE AND POINT-OF-SALE TERMINAL

A non-transitory computer-readable medium is configured to store instructions executable by one or more processors to perform operations including receiving, via an audio signal interface, audio data, processing the audio data to identify one or more speakers from which the audio data is produced, determining, from the processed audio data, an intention to place one or more orders, and communicating, in response to determining the intention, with at least one point-of-sale (POS) terminal to execute order processing.

UTILIZING MACHINE LEARNING TO GENERATE VEHICLE INFORMATION FOR A VEHICLE CAPTURED BY A USER DEVICE IN A VEHICLE LOT

A device receives vehicle data associated with vehicles located at a vehicle dealership lot, and receives, from a user device, profile data identifying a user of the user device and data identifying a particular vehicle of the vehicles. The device compares the data identifying the particular vehicle and the vehicle data to determine particular vehicle data associated with the particular vehicle, and processes the particular vehicle data and the profile data of the user, with a first model, to determine purchase options for the particular vehicle and the user. The device provides, to the user device, the particular vehicle data and the purchase options for the particular vehicle to cause the user device to display the particular vehicle data and the purchase options for the particular vehicle.

INVENTORY MANAGEMENT SYSTEM, INVENTORY MANAGEMENT METHOD, AND INVENTORY MANAGEMENT PROGRAM
20230368134 · 2023-11-16 ·

An inventory of a product is managed on the basis of the remaining number of products specified by reading an electronic tag.

An inventory management system including: an electronic tag that stores tag information for specifying a product and is attached to the product; a measurement apparatus that is installed within a measurement range of the electronic tag and measures the tag information; and a server apparatus, in which the server apparatus includes: a registration means that stores a consumption unit set by a quantity of one or more of the products, and an appropriate inventory quantity set on the basis of the consumption unit in a storage unit as inventory management information regarding the product, an acquisition means that acquires a remaining number of the products specified by the tag information measured by the measurement apparatus, and an order placement means that refers to the inventory management information and outputs order placement data of the product when it is determined that the remaining number of the product is less than the appropriate inventory quantity.

Method for tracking products using distributed, shared registration bases and random numbers generated by quantum processes
11810179 · 2023-11-07 ·

A method for tracking products, involving a subprocess (100) for generating and associating codes with products, and a subprocess (200) for acquiring products is provided, which enable the consumer, by using his/her smartphone, directly to identify forged, adulterated or stolen products or those containing any information supplied by the manufacturer that prohibits the sale thereof, transforming the consumer into an active element in an integrated control system. The consumer becomes a terminal in a network, fully equipped with online communication and information tools, in addition to cameras and other sensors, making the consumer a potential agent for authenticating products and goods in general. Furthermore, a method (300) for validating encounters, capable of authenticating and validating an encounter between two or more mobile devices or between a mobile device and a fixed device is provided, the method (300) authenticating an encounter between two persons by use of their smartphones.

Method for Online Ordering Using Conversational Interface
20230368167 · 2023-11-16 ·

Embodiments of the invention provide a method, system and computer program product for online ordering using conversational interfaces. In an embodiment of the invention, the method includes storing customer information corresponding to a customer and responsive to receiving a message with text or speech and an image from the customer, identifying an intent type from the text or speech using Natural Language Understanding, identifying a product or service from the image using image classification techniques and transmitting a product detail message to the customer with the product or service and corresponding pricing using Natural Language Generation. The method further includes responsive to receiving an affirmative message from the customer in response to the product detail message identified as affirmative using Natural Language Understanding, automatically completing a purchase of the product or service with the customer information and transmitting a receipt message to the customer with an order receipt.

Digital Marketplace

Novel tools and techniques are provided for implementing a digital marketplace for providing a user experience (“UX”) for customers to order and configure network services that are subsequently autonomously provisioned via a network(s). In various embodiments, a digital marketplace is provided for providing a UX for customers to order and configure network services or telephony services that are subsequently autonomously provisioned via a network(s), in some cases, autonomously provisioning and (pre)configuring, on customer premises equipment (“CPE”), network services or telephony services that are purchased via the UX, either before shipping the CPE or after the CPE has been shipped to, and installed at, the customer premises.